The Golden Globe Award-winning drama series, The Affair, finally has its Season 4 trailer out. With a stellar cast of Golden Globe nominees like Dominic, Ruth Wilson, and Emmy Award nominee and Golden Globe winner Maura Tierney and Screen Actors Guild Award nominee Joshua Jackson starring in Showtime's drama, it's for sure that the upcoming season is going to be a thrilling ride.

The season will premiere on Sunday, June 17 at 9 p.m. ET/PT, and explores the emotional and psychological effects of an affair that destroyed two marriages, and the crime that brings these individuals back together. In Season four, Noah (West), Helen (Tierney), Alison (Wilson) and Cole (Jackson) are in their own orbits, alienated from each other, spinning further and further away from where they all began.

Every character is involved in a new relationship, forcing them each to decide if they’re ready and willing to leave the past behind for good – with a season about new beginnings, tragic ends and the ever-elusive possibility of forgiveness.

Joining this season will be Sanaa Lathan (Shots Fired) as Janelle, the tough-as-nails principal of the charter school where Noah teaches. Ramon Rodriguez (Iron Fist) guest stars as Ben, a Marine veteran now employed by the VHA and Alison's new love interest. Additional season four guest stars include Russell Hornsby (Grimm), Christopher Meyer (The Fosters), Amy Irving (Yentl) and Phoebe Tonkin (The Vampire Diaries).

The series was created by Writers Guild Award-winning playwright and writer/producer Sarah Treem (House of Cards, In Treatment) and Hagai Levi (In Treatment). They are also the executive producers, along with Jessica Rhodes for season four.

At the same time, Showtime is also giving viewers the chance to sample the Golden Globe-winning first season of the show, viewing its all 10 episodes for free on YouTube, Facebook and SHO.com, as well as across multiple television and streaming providers’ devices, websites, applications and authenticated online services and their free On Demand channels.

Along with that, all three seasons of The Affair are currently available to Showtime subscribers, on streaming, authenticated and on-demand platforms including Showtime On Demand and Showtime Anytime.
